基于P2P技术的即时通信系统研究与实现
| 论文之家 | 代写论文 | 发表论文 | 站点地图 | 收藏本站 |
您现在的位置: 硕士论文 >> 电子论文 >> 计算机 >> 计算机软件 >> 正文
基于P2P技术的即时通信系统研究与实现
作者:关峪 Publish: 2007-4-27 Hits:-
【中文题名】 基于P2P技术的即时通信系统研究与实现
【英文题名】 The Research and Realization of Instant Messaging System Based on P2P
【学科专业】 模式识别与智能系统
【论文级别】 硕士论文
【投稿时间】 2007-4-27
【中关键词】 印刷行业,即时通信系统,P2P,文件传输,,
【英关键词】 Printing Industry,Instant Messaging System,P2P,File Transferring,
【分类导航】 工业技术>自动化技术、计算机技术>计算技术、计算机技术>计算机的应用>计算机网络>一般性问题
【论文摘要】  随着网络技术的发展,即时通信(Instant Messaging)正在成为在线活动中不可或缺的业务。从个人即时通信向企业即时通信的演化,是目前即时通信领域的研究热点。企业版的即时通信软件的诞生,给企业的管理带来了新的思路和手段。推动了企业工作效率的提高,办公费用的降低,引起了工程应用领域的研究热潮。本文将介绍一种应印刷行业需求,根据该行业业务特点所开发的即时通信系统。该系统基于P2P技术实现了企业间高效的点对点互联,克服了:刻录光盘人工递送方式、后来用到的E-Mail方式以及FTP方式等印刷业传统业务方式弊病,为印刷出版行业提供优质的即时通信服务。 本文论述了企业即时通信系统的研究现状、发展趋势和存在问题;提出了针对印刷行业基于P2P技术的即时通信系统的技术路线;探讨了C/S架构和P2P技术,应用于即时通信的SIP协议栈,数据库技术等基础理论以及穿越NAT/防火墙实现对等互联的核心策略。在此基础上提出了基于P2P的即时通信系统的结构模型,并描述了该系统中各模块的功能特点;重点介绍了针对印刷业的即时通信系统的核心模块——文件传输设计与实现,该模块采用以基于P2P技术为主,C/S方式作为有力补充...
【论文题纲】
中文摘要 5-6
ABSTRACT 6-10
1 引言 10-13
1.1 课题研究背景 10
1.2 课题任务 10-11
1.3 作者所作的工作 11-12
1.4 论文的结构组成 12
1.5 本章小结 12-13
2 即时通信在企业中的应用 13-16
2.1 即时通信应用范围 13-14
2.2 即时通信在印刷行业中的应用 14
2.3 即时通信企业级应用中存在的问题 14-15
2.4 企业应用管理和技术并重 15
2.5 本章小结 15-16
3 相关知识与关键技术 16-45
3.1 客户/服务器程序 16-20
3.1.1 客户/服务模式的采用 16-17
3.1.2 客户/服务器模式工作原理 17
3.1.3 客户/服务器模式结构与程序设计 17-20
3.2 P2P 技术的应用 20-36
3.2.1 P2P 的概念 20
3.2.2 P2P 特点 20-21
3.2.3 P2P 的发展现状 21-23
3.2.4 P2P 技术与现有互联技术的比较 23-25
3.2.5 P2P 通信 25-33
3.2.6 P2P 在企业中的应用 33-34
3.2.7 P2P 信任与安全性分析 34-35
3.2.8 P2P 存在的问题及解决方案 35-36
3.3 SIP 在即时通信中的应用 36-41
3.3.1 SIP 简介 36-38
3.3.2 基于SIP 协议的即时通信体系 38-41
3.4 Visual C++的网络编程 41-43
3.4.1 套接字网络编程原理 41-42
3.4.2 基于 MFC CSocket 类的客户/服务器应用程序 42-43
3.4.3 多线程技术 43
3.5 数据库的访问技术——ADO 技术 43-44
3.6 本章小结 44-45
4 易印通即时通信系统概述 45-60
4.1 用户特点 45-46
4.2 系统的设计 46-49
4.2.1 系统设计思路 46-48
4.2.2 系统总体架构 48-49
4.3 系统功能概述 49-54
4.3.1 用户在线状态控制 49-50
4.3.2 文字通信 50-51
4.3.3 订单业务 51-52
4.3.4 文件传输 52-54
4.4 系统数据库的设计 54-57
4.4.1 个人信息类 54-56
4.4.2 企业信息类 56
4.4.3 订单相关信息类 56-57
4.5 性能需求 57-58
4.6 系统开发环境与运行环境 58
4.6.1 开发环境 58
4.6.2 系统运行环境 58
4.7 本章小结 58-60
5 P2P 文件传输功能模块的设计与实现 60-74
5.1 模块功能 60
5.2 模块总体设计 60-63
5.3 模块功能的实现 63-69
5.4 测试 69-71
5.4.1 测试环境(硬件和软件) 69-70
5.4.2 单元测试 70
5.4.3 系统测试 70-71
5.5 文件传输共享新思路 71-73
5.5.1 设计思想 72-73
5.6 小结 73-74
6 全文总结与应用展望 74-79
6.1 全文工作总结 74
6.2 系统现状 74-75
6.3 系统特色 75
6.4 系统有待改进的方面 75-79
6.4.1 增加更多功能 76
6.4.2 文件传输模块性能优化 76-77
6.4.3 程序实现问题 77
6.4.4 安全性 77
6.4.5 互通性 77-79
参考文献 79-81
作者简历 81-82
【DOI】 LunWen.ID:2.2008.357391
付费论文:有参考文献 300元
1、注册会员             2、购买本文            3、下载文章 
注:此文为收费论文,需付费购买。每页大约1000字。
代写论文流程
载入中…
Web lunwenjia
热门搜索:印刷行业 论文 即时通信系统 P2P 文件传输
计算机软件最新论文
计算机软件热门论文